Abstract

The invention discloses an experimental platform for simulating a container ship to overcome water elasticity, which comprises an experimental water tank, a small ship is arranged in the experimental water tank, concave seats are mounted on the left and right sides of the lower inner wall, the front inner wall and the rear inner wall of the experimental water tank, sliding grooves are formed in the two sides of each concave seat, and first sliding plates are slidably connected in the concave seats; sliding blocks are fixedly connected to the two sides of the first sliding plate and slidably connected with the corresponding sliding grooves, pressure sensors are installed on the upper sides and the lower sides of the sliding grooves, springs are connected between the sliding blocks and the pressure sensors, and the first sliding plate is connected with the small boat. The motor drives the threaded cylinder to move left and right, then the rotating rods on the left and right sides are pulled to rotate, the sliding frames on the left and right sides are driven to slide up and down oppositely, the rotating plates are stirred to rotate, waves are formed, water elasticity is generated, the experiment boat floats, the sliding plates are pulled through the hanging ropes, and the sliding blocks are driven to compress the springs on the respective sides. Therefore, each pressure sensor can monitor the stress data under various conditions.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an experimental platform, in particular to an experimental platform for simulating container ships to overcome water elasticity. Background technique [0002] Container ships are transport ships that mainly carry containers. Its cargo capacity is measured in tonnage, or in the number of 20-foot equivalent units (TEU) or 40-foot equivalent units (FEU) loaded. A container ship is a completely new type of ship. It has no internal deck, the engine room is located in the stern, the hull is actually a huge warehouse, up to 300 meters long, and then divided into small cabins by vertical rails. When the container is unloaded, these container devices play a positioning role, and when the ship encounters bad weather at sea, they can firmly hold the container.
